FileSystem.SetAttr(String, FileAttribute) Metódus
Definíció
Fontos
Egyes információk olyan, kiadás előtti termékekre vonatkoznak, amelyek a kiadásig még jelentősen módosulhatnak. A Microsoft nem vállal kifejezett vagy törvényi garanciát az itt megjelenő információért.
Beállítja egy fájl attribútumadatait. A My funkció jobb hatékonyságot és teljesítményt biztosít a fájl I/O-műveletekben, mint SetAttra . További információért lásd FileSystem.
public:
static void SetAttr(System::String ^ PathName, Microsoft::VisualBasic::FileAttribute Attributes);
public static void SetAttr(string PathName, Microsoft.VisualBasic.FileAttribute Attributes);
static member SetAttr : string * Microsoft.VisualBasic.FileAttribute -> unit
Public Sub SetAttr (PathName As String, Attributes As FileAttribute)
Paraméterek
- PathName
- String
Kötelező. Egy fájlnevet meghatározó sztringkifejezés.
PathName könyvtárat vagy mappát és meghajtót is tartalmazhat.
- Attributes
- FileAttribute
Kötelező. Állandó vagy numerikus kifejezés, amelynek összege fájlattribútumokat határoz meg.
Kivételek
Attribute érvénytelen típus.
Példák
Ez a példa a függvényt használja egy SetAttr fájl attribútumainak beállításához.
' Set hidden attribute.
SetAttr("TESTFILE", vbHidden)
' Set hidden and read-only attributes.
SetAttr("TESTFILE", vbHidden Or vbReadOnly)
Megjegyzések
Futásidejű hiba akkor fordul elő, ha egy megnyitott fájl attribútumait próbálja beállítani.
Az Attributes argumentum enumerálási értékei a következők:
| Érték | Állandó | Leírás |
|---|---|---|
Normal |
vbNormal |
Normál (alapértelmezett). |
ReadOnly |
vbReadOnly |
Read-only. |
Hidden |
vbHidden |
Rejtett. |
System |
vbSystem |
Rendszerfájl. |
Volume |
vbVolume |
Kötetcímke |
Directory |
vbDirectory |
Könyvtár vagy mappa. |
Archive |
vbArchive |
A fájl megváltozott a legutóbbi biztonsági mentés óta. |
Alias |
vbAlias |
A fájlnak más a neve. |
Note
Ezeket az enumerálásokat a Visual Basic nyelv határozza meg. A nevek a tényleges értékek helyett bárhol használhatók a kódban.